Inglewood Estate photographs best when the day is built around a few strong parts of the property rather than trying to cover everything. It helps to decide early how much of exclusive-use flow belongs in the gallery, because too much of the same backdrop can flatten the story. Timing matters more than extra movement here; once the light softens around vineyard setting, the gallery tends to feel much more resolved. If the ceremony is outdoors, it is worth checking orientation, aisle direction, and how the backdrop will sit once guests are in place. When the schedule stays realistic, the photographs usually feel grounded in the venue rather than borrowed from a generic winery template.
